🔥 Как вывести двоичную запись числа в Питон? Учимся работать с бинарными числами в Питоне! 💻
bin()
. Вот пример:
число = 42
двоичная_запись = bin(число)
print(двоичная_запись)
В этом примере мы определяем переменную число
и присваиваем ей значение 42. Затем мы используем функцию bin()
для получения двоичной записи этого числа. Результат сохраняется в переменной двоичная_запись
. Наконец, мы выводим двоичную запись на экран с помощью функции print()
.
Запуск этого кода покажет вам двоичную запись числа 42, которая будет выглядеть как '0b101010'
.
Удачи с программированием!
Детальный ответ
Как вывести двоичную запись числа в Python
Для того, чтобы вывести двоичную запись числа в Python, мы можем использовать встроенную функцию bin(). Давайте рассмотрим примеры использования этой функции.
Пример 1: Вывод двоичной записи числа
Для того, чтобы вывести двоичную запись числа на экран, нужно передать это число в функцию bin(). Например, если мы хотим вывести двоичное представление числа 10, мы можем сделать следующее:
number = 10
binary = bin(number)
print(binary)
В результате выполнения этого кода, на экране появится строка "0b1010". Обратите внимание, что "0b" - это префикс, который указывает на то, что следующие цифры представляют двоичное число.
Пример 2: Использование форматирования
Что если мы хотим только получить двоичную запись числа без префикса "0b"? В таком случае, мы можем использовать форматирование строк, чтобы исключить префикс.
number = 10
binary = bin(number)[2:] # Используем срез, чтобы исключить первые два символа
print(binary)
Теперь, при выполнении кода, мы получим только строку "1010", которая представляет двоичное число 10.
Пример 3: Форматирование с ведущими нулями
Иногда нам может потребоваться, чтобы двоичное число содержало определенное количество битовых разрядов. В таком случае, мы можем использовать функцию format() для форматирования строки с ведущими нулями.
number = 10
binary = format(number, '08b') # Форматируем число с 8 битовыми разрядами и ведущими нулями
print(binary)
В данном примере мы получим строку "00001010", которая представляет двоичное число 10 с ведущими нулями.
Заключение
Теперь вы знаете, как вывести двоичную запись числа в Python. Вы можете использовать встроенную функцию bin() для получения двоичного представления числа. Также, с помощью форматирования строк, вы можете исключить префикс "0b" и добавить ведущие нули при необходимости.